Output 50fd3fd2e02d90aefa3bbcd08773222e18f8bca138335657646234f335721c75:3

value
15037092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ad690432bdf0f35b2892f536c645674f37c422a OP_EQUAL
address
38WixsfKMspmKzRhyJquMy9wvwQmFRezHB
transaction
50fd3fd2e02d90aefa3bbcd08773222e18f8bca138335657646234f335721c75
confirmations
453241
spent
true